How Much Is 1.5 Liters of Heavy Cream in Grams?

Converting 1.5 liters of heavy cream to grams gives 1,508.95 g. One liter of heavy cream weighs 1,005.97g, so 1.5 liters is 1.5 × 1,005.97 = 1,508.95g. This conversion is specific to heavy cream because each ingredient has a different density.

Formula and Step-by-Step

liters × 1,005.97g/L = grams
  1. Start with 1.5 liters of heavy cream
  2. 1 liter of heavy cream = 1,005.97g
  3. 1.5 × 1,005.97 = 1,508.95g

The same formula works for any amount. Multiply (or divide) by the density, then convert units as needed.

Measuring Tip

Liquid densities vary: oils weigh less per cup than water, while syrups and honey weigh more. This is why ingredient-specific conversions matter even for liquids.

Understanding the Units

What is a Liter?

Liters are the same everywhere, unlike cups, pints, and gallons which vary between US and imperial systems. This consistency is one reason professional kitchens worldwide prefer metric measurements.

What is a Gram?

Grams are the preferred unit in professional kitchens and bakeries because they allow exact recipe scaling. To double a recipe, simply double the gram values. No need to worry about how tightly an ingredient is packed into a cup.
